The prompt

Create a cylindrical cordless-drill gearbox housing as a single manufacturable plastic component. The main body should be a hollow cylindrical shell with a stepped outer diameter. Add a larger circular mounting flange at the front with a large concentric central opening. Add four evenly spaced mounting holes around the front flange. Include four longitudinal external reinforcing ribs connecting the main cylindrical body to the front flange. Add a smaller stepped cylindrical section at the rear for locating the motor/gearbox assembly. Use consistent thin wall thickness, rounded fillets at rib and flange transitions, and smooth injection-mouldable geometry. Keep the design mechanically realistic, symmetrical around the main shaft axis, lightweight, and relatively simple. Do not add gears, motor, chuck, screws, threads, logos, cosmetic details, or complex surface styling.
